什么是以太坊钱包RPC? 在了解以太坊钱包RPC接口之前,我们需要先理解“RPC”这一概念。RPC即远程过程调用(Remote...
大家都知道,比特币是一种数字货币,而比特币钱包则是用来存储和管理这些数字货币的工具。而比特币钱包API,顾名思义,就是一组允许开发者通过程序来与比特币钱包进行交互的接口。
说简单点,API就像一个桥梁,让你能在你的应用程序和比特币钱包之间传递数据。你可以通过它来查看余额、发送比特币、接收比特币,甚至进行交易历史查询。假如你是个想要开发比特币相关应用的人,这东西简直是太重要了。
很多人一听到技术就觉得无聊、复杂,但其实使用比特币钱包API的好处非常直观。首先,快!通过API,你可以以很快的速度完成操作。想想看,如果每次你都要手动登录钱包,才能发送比特币,那得浪费多少时间啊?
再来,安全性也是个不小的问题。API一般会有身份验证、加密等安全措施,能帮助你更好地保护自己的资产。比如说,有些API在每次发起交易前都需要确认,这就避免了因为错误的操作导致的损失。
还有就是可扩展性。假如你现在有自己的应用,想要添加一些比特币支付的功能,使用API能让你少走很多弯路。你只需要调用API就可以了,不用从头开始搞。
市场上有很多比特币钱包API,选择时可以从几个方面考虑。第一,功能。不同的API提供的功能大不相同,有的支持更广泛的技术,有的则只支持基础的发送和接收,你需要根据自己的需求来选择。
第二,可靠性。可以看看其他开发者的评价,了解他们对该API的使用体验。好的API会有稳定的性能和友好的文档,遇到问题时,还能快速得到支持。
第三,费用。有些API是免费的,但通常功能会有限;而一些收费的API则会提供更多的功能和更好的服务。根据你的预算,做出合理的选择。
现在聊聊市面上比较流行的一些比特币钱包API。比如说,Blockchain.info的API就非常受欢迎。这家公司的API功能齐全,而且文档也很详细。用户评价不错,适合初学者的使用。
另一个比较知名的API是Coinbase。这个API不仅支持比特币,还支持其他一些主流的加密货币。它的界面友好,特别适合想要打造多币种钱包的开发者。
最后还有一个较新的API,BitPay。相较于前面两者,BitPay更加关注于商业支付,也就是支持商家接受比特币支付,特别适合那些想要入驻比特币市场的商家。
接下来,我们来聊聊如何实际使用这些API。第一步,你需要注册一个账号,很多API在使用前都需要你通过平台注册。这个过程通常比较简单,按照要求填写相关信息就行了。
第二步,获取API密钥。这个密钥是一个唯一的字符串,你在调用API时需要包括它,以证明你的身份。每个API的获取方式不太一样,一般文档里都会说明如何获取。
第三步,阅读文档。在你开始写代码之前,先认真看看API的文档。里面会有如何调用接口、每个接口需要的参数、返回数据的格式等详细信息。搞清楚这些,能让你少走很多弯路。
最后,开始编写代码。无论你使用的是Java、Python还是其他语言,只需按文档提供的示例来编写代码。试着做一些简单的操作,比如查询余额、发送比特币,慢慢熟悉API的用法。
使用比特币钱包API时,难免会遇到一些问题。比如,有时候请求返回的数据格式不对,或者请求失败。这些问题通常可以从文档中找答案。很多API都会详细列出常见的错误代码和相应的解决方案。
另外,还有些开发者会担心安全性。其实,大部分API都会有很好的安全措施,比如使用HTTPS来加密数据传输,同时,还会要求你定期更新密钥和密码,保持安全。
总的来说,使用比特币钱包API其实没那么难。你只需按照步骤去做,慢慢摸索,就能轻松上手。记得多花点时间在文档上,跟一些技术论坛的人交流交流,让自己的问题得到解决。
想想之前我刚接触时,也是对一切都感到无从下手,但后来通过反复的实践,逐渐掌握了。UI界面、错误提示都成了我的朋友,API的使用变得得心应手。如果我能做到,你也一定没问题!
这些经验分享给你们,希望能帮你更好地使用比特币钱包API!如果还有其他问题,欢迎随时交流!